shutdownlog entry: Reboot after panic: Data page fault

How do I analyze the crash in
/var/adm/crash/crash.3 to verify
what caused this? HPUX 11i V1
Model T520

Douglass,

Contact your HP response centre and ask for the latest copy of crashinfo to be sent out. This is a contributed tool (ie not hp-supported) but is used by the Response Centre folks to perform a first-pass crashdump analysis.

If you have ISEE installed in your setup, then it may already exist on an SPOP.

Run it without any options and peruse the output for any clues (eg most recent contents of message buffer and process stack trace for the panic event)

If you raise a support case then this would be useful info to send in to hp too.
